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Diagnosis of an invasive malignant disorder
- Moderate to severe fatigue within the past 4 weeks, defined as a score of ≥ 2 (on a scale of 0-4) on the Functional Assessment of Chronic Illness Therapy-Fatigue (FACIT-F) question "I feel fatigued"
- Age 18 and over
-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group (ECOG) Performance status of 0-3
- Negative pregnancy test
- Fertile patients must use effective contraception during and for 3 months after study participation
Exclusion
- Brain metastases
- Hemoglobin \< 9 g/dL, taken \<=4 weeks prior to registration
- Severe, uncontrolled liver disease
- Evidence of severely compromised renal function including any 1 of the following:
- Renal failure
- End stage renal disease
- Ongoing renal dialysis
- Severe, uncontrolled cardiovascular disease
- Severe, uncontrolled pulmonary disease
- Pregnant or nursing
- History of seizures
- Known sensitivity to carnitine
- Delirium
- Nausea \> grade 1
- Taking any form of levocarnitine (L-carnitine) supplementation or nutritional supplements containing carnitine within 2 months prior to registration
